Seadog writes: Friday, November, 21, 2008 12:18 PM
I don't know about domestic
turkeys, but wild turkeys can fly pretty well, or so it seems. I was driving around the hill from my farm in West Virginia when I startled a flock of wild turkeys gleaning bugs from the grass above the road. They lifted off, sailed down the hill and disappeared in the woods at the foot of the hill -- probably close to one-half mile distance from lift-off. Surprised heck outta me! I'd never seen turkeys do anything except fly a short distance to roost in a tree. I'm pretty sure they were riding the air currents, but they were flying.

Domestic turkeys are only slightly smarter than a three-toed sloth! There are cases of them holding their heads up, beaks open and drowning in heavy rainstorms. They will also pack into a fence corner and smother each other. They rank right up there with sheep for doing dumb things!

Wild turkeys are smart! Ask folks who hunt 'em -- they are very difficult to locate during turkey season. A friend, an avid hunter, says that killing a turkey in season is a major accomplishment!

Seadog writes: Saturday, November, 22, 2008 10:36 AM
I doubt that obesity has
anything to do with domestic turkeys not flying. Domestic turkeys are slaughtered at a certain weight, depending on the market for which the farmer is producing them. Domestic turkeys are flat stupid!

A flock of wild turkeys hang around my farm. They are HUGE, compared with turkeys I see growing on farms. They are fearless too. They often walk right past me in the meadow or the front yard. Now, that said -- don't look for them to do that during turkey season. They are no where to be seen. I have asked folks who hunt how the turkeys know when turkey season comes, but have never received an answer. They openly parade around during other hunting seasons, even when guns are popping off in the woods and on the hills -- don't seem to bother them except during turkey season. Weird!
